Easter Dirt Cake Casserole Recipe

Indulge in this delightful Easter Dirt Cake Casserole, a fun and festive dessert perfect for spring celebrations. Layers of creamy pudding, crushed cookies, and whimsical decorations make this no-bake treat a hit with both kids and adults alike.

Ingredients

Units Scale

Cream Cheese Mixture:

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up powdered sugar

Pudding Layer:

  • 2 packages (3.4 oz each) instant vanilla pudding mix
  • 3 cups cold milk

Additional Ingredients:

  • 1 package (14.3 oz) chocolate sandwich cookies, crushed
  • 12 oz whipped topping, thawed
  • Pastel-colored sprinkles
  • Mini chocolate eggs
  • Bunny-shaped candies for decorating

Instructions

  1. Cream Cheese Mixture: In a large mixing bowl, beat cream cheese, butter, and powdered sugar until smooth and creamy.
  2. Pudding Layer: In another bowl, whisk together pudding mix and cold milk until thickened. Fold pudding into cream cheese mixture, then gently fold in whipped topping until fully combined.
  3. Assembly: Spread half of the crushed cookies in a 9×13-inch baking dish. Pour pudding mixture over the cookies, smooth it out, and top with remaining crushed cookies.
  4. Decorate: Add pastel sprinkles, mini chocolate eggs, and bunny candies on top. Refrigerate for at least 2 hours before serving.

Notes

  • You can make this dessert a day ahead—it gets even better as it chills.
  • For a fun touch, use crushed golden sandwich cookies and tint the pudding with pastel food coloring.
